Wonderbolt Productions is ecstatic to announce the 4th annual St. John’s International CircusFest (SJICF) will be live and in-person this coming September 23rd - 26th, 2021!

With local artists and renowned Circus companies from Québec now able to join us at the edge of the world, we’re planning all kinds of industry panels, fun parties, outrageous new performances, and – oh, did we mention the parties?!! Building on the success of previous years’ sold-out performances, SJICF is also returning to the stage!

We’re partnering with some of Canada’s biggest names in Circus to bring their latest shows to St. John’s. However, as last year’s digital festival proved, online events are incredible popular and very effective in reaching those who can’t yet make the trip to Newfoundland.

Last year’s online industry panels and workshops were very popular with the International Circus community, so with this in mind, SJICF plans to expand and further integrate our digital events into our live and in-person events. Industry web panels and workshops will again be broadcast from Memorial University’s Emera Innovation Exchange (EIX) to properly host our digital gatherings and ensure we present the best video quality possible.
